WHAT:  Spring 2011 Support Staff Training
WHEN:  Thursday, March 31, 2011, Registration 9:30 - 10:00, Training 10:00 - 12:00, Lunch 12:00 - 1:00, Training 1:00 - 3:00
WHERE:  Moore-Norman Technology Center, Franklin Road Campus, 4701 12th Avenue, Norman, Oklahoma
Cost:  FREE

This is an excellent opportunity for the Support Staff in your office to receive free Professional Training.

Joyce Allman, Ph. D., Associate Provost for Academic Advising Oversight at the University of Oklahoma will be presenting the morning session, 'Exemplary Service is More than a Smile".

*         Service is an element of financial aid that is sometimes overlooked, yet attention to this area is important in addressing issues facing our students.  Using an analogy of a fine dining experience, we see that it is possible to have a sense of style, refinement, and sophistication in our interaction with students.  How we present our offices, our services, ourselves, as well as offering "little things" to give students stellar service can make a big difference in a student's college experience.  The models and tips are easily duplicated at any university, as the communication concepts are basic, but thoughtful.
The afternoon sessions will be presented by OGSLP staff.  The Policy, Compliance and Training department will conduct training on the following topics:

*         Dealing with Difficult People at Work - Get five tips about dealing with co-workers who are cranky, aggressive, subtle snipers, complainers and silent avoiders.

*         Successful Workplace Communication - Establish effective communication habits at work and home by practicing the four C's: consistency, clarity, compromise and confidence.
